hola, estoy haciendo un guestbook... y hay algo de todo q no me sale... y estuve toda la tarde toqueteando cosas... q cuando descubra q es voy a tener mal otra por tanto toquetear xD, asi q pense q me podian dar una manito...
esto no lo estoy haciendo con ningun tutorial... tocando de oido xD...
primero esta el guestbook.html
<HTML>
<HEAD>
<TITLE>Guestbook</TITLE>
</HEAD>
<BODY>
<form action="guestbook.php" method="post">
<b> De:</b> <br> <input type="text" name="de"><br> <br>
<b> Comentario:</b> <br> <textarea type="text" name="comentario" rows="5" cols="40" wrap="virtual"></textarea>
<input type="submit" value="Enviar comentario">
</BODY>
</HTML>
esto lo re toquetie, no me extrañaria q este mal xD ...
el guestbook.php
<html>
<head>
<?php
$de=$_POST['de'];
$comentario=$_POST['comentario']
$guardame=fopen("guardaaca.html", a);
fwrite($guardame, "
".$de."
".$comentario."
"."<br><hr><br>");
fclose($guardame)
?>
<meta http-equiv="refresh" content="0;URL=guardaaca.html">
</head>
</html>
como me costo hacer q aparezca un espacio y una linea entre comentarios y comentarios xD es una de las cosas q toquetie y quedo bn xD...
bueno no se q opinan...
basicamente se tendria q guardar en guardaaca.html ...
pero al poner los datos y darle a enviar comentario, a lo siguiente q seria el guestbook.php me dice Parse error: syntax error, unexpected T_VARIABLE in D:\AppServ\www\modulares\guestbook.php on line 6
se puede ver q la linea 6 es esta
$guardame=fopen("guardaaca.html", a);
lo q me parece mas raro porq nunca tube problema con esa linea... esa y la mayor parte de guestbook.php la copie de un video, en q hacia otra cosa nada q ver xD lo use solo para anotarlo en guardaaca.html q es donde se verian todos los comentarios...
espero aver sido claro....
por supuesto sigo buscando, pero quien sabe, por ahi es una pavada q alguno de ustedes me puede aclarar... algun despiste...
salu2, desde ya grax...
Modifica
$guardame=fopen("guardaaca.html", a);
$guardame=fopen("guardaaca.html", "a");
a guestbook.html le fatla la etiqueta </form>
Saludos
sigo teniendo ese problema en la linea 6 ...
pd: modifique el guestbook.html en la parte de input lo cambie por un textarea fijate si sigue estando bn...
salu2, habra q seguir intentando xD
xD vdd
la linea 5 colocala asi
$comentario=$_POST['comentario'];
Saludos
jaj! gracias!!
sabia q era una pavada xD anda perfectamente :D
ahora estoy pensando q podria hacer la pagina de comentarios mas linda... simplemente mandando la inf directamente a un php usando las variables en el codigo fuente... y q despues se reemplacen solas por la informacion...
no se si me explico... bueno en fin...
Solucionado.
comentarios.php <?php $archivo = file("comentarios.txt"); $filas = count($archivo); for($i=0;$i<$filas;$i++) { $campo = explode("|",$archivo[$i]); $nombre = $campo[0]; $comentario = $campo[1]; echo "\n<p>$nombre<br> <p>$comentario<br></p><br>"; } ?> <p align="center"><a href="guestbook">regresar</a></p> ahora solo crea este archivo comentarios.txt para mas informacion deja un comentario en esta pagina http://forosmms.3a2.com